The film’s title refers to Mahmud of Ghazni, whose name is pronounced "Ghajini" in Tamil, symbolizing the protagonist's relentless pursuit of his goal despite repeated setbacks [ 0.5.2 ].
is a highly acclaimed Tamil-language action thriller directed by A.R. Murugadoss, starring Suriya, Asin, and Nayanthara. The film's story follows Sanjay Ramasamy (Suriya), a wealthy businessman suffering from anterograde amnesia—he cannot form new memories and forgets everything every 15 minutes. He tattoos clues on his body to hunt down the murderer of his love interest, Kalpana (Asin), a medical student and model. The villain, Ghajini Dharmatma (Pradeep Rawat), is a ruthless gangster.
